#e7128e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e7128e is composed of 90.6% red, 7.1%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 92.2% magenta, 38.5% yellow and 9.4% black. It has a hue angle of 325.1 degrees, a saturation of 85.5% and a lightness of 48.8%. #e7128e color hex could be obtained by blending #ff24ff with #cf001d. Closest websafe color is: #ff0099.

#e7128e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e7128e has RGB values of R:231, G:18, B:142 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.92, Y:0.39,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15143566.

Shades and Tints of #e7128e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0108 is the darkest color, while #fff9f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#e7128e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7b7d is the less saturated color, while #f10890 is the most saturated one.
